TEST RIDE AN RP: Trial Policy We know how difficult it can be to choose a saddle. We also understand that the ReactorPanel saddle must be experienced to be appreciated. That's why we believe that you should only make such an important—and expensive—decision after thoroughly testing a saddle you're considering purchasing. Since we won't sell a saddle without a successful trial, your first step is ordering a saddle for evaluation. We will do our best to supply your "dream" saddle, so if you decide to buy a ReactorPanel, you can simply keep the one you have on hand. Our evaluation policy is straightforward and, if you fit the saddle yourself, free (except for freight and insurance). While fitting does not require special skills, you need to be patient and enjoy working with your hands to be successful. HOW DOES THE EVALUATION PROGRAM WORK? ORDERING A TEST SADDLE To fulfill your order, we need a completed Evaluation Agreement and tracings of your horse as specified in our Template Guide. Let us know if you need help choosing the model and your seat size. MEASURING A HORSE In the Template Guide, we ask for four photos of your horse. Below are samples of the photos we request.
WHEN WILL IT SHIP? Evaluation saddles typically ship on the day your order is received. If we don't have an appropriate saddle in stock, we will inform you immediately. The typical wait is 10 days or fewer. FITTING Fitting the saddle does not require special skills, but it does require patience and a good eye for symmetry. If you will be fitting the saddle yourself, set aside a good block of time (at least two to three hours). We will provide unlimited telephone support for your fitting session and during your trial. If you would prefer to have fitting assistance, check to see if we have a Fitting Agent or upcoming Fitting Clinic near you. RIDING Test the saddle thoroughly during your trial. If necessary, take it trail riding, to a lesson or clinic, or let others ride in it. We ask you to keep initial rides short for your horse's benefit, giving him time to get used to the freedom the saddle provides. If you believe you will need more than two weeks or want to compete in one of our saddles, call us to discuss your needs and options. CONCLUDING THE TRIAL Our goal with the test period is your definitive "yes" or "no" decision about the saddle, so the test interval lasts two weeks, with minimal restrictions. Please call (888-771-4402) or email info@reactorpanel.com with any detailed questions. BUY A SADDLE At ReactorPanel, we believe that you should never buy a saddle you haven't personally tested. Therefore, before you buy a ReactorPanel saddle, you must order a saddle for evaluation. If you haven't already done so, please read our Trial Policy. Once you have successfully concluded your trial, you may choose to purchase the saddle you've been testing. If your test saddle was close but not ideal, we carry a large inventory and will probably be able to ship you a new saddle immediately. If you decide you would rather custom order (or if your horse has physical characteristics that make a custom tree necessary), our order package guides you through the process of configuring your custom saddle. (link to Custom Saddle Order) You will be able to choose every detail, from leather type and color to billet length. Custom saddles typically take 6-10 weeks to arrive in the U.S. from the factory in Walsall, England. |
